Graf honored as softball's first Academic All-America selection

AUSTIN, Texas – Senior pitcher Julie Graf became the St. Olaf College softball program's first-ever College Sports Information Directors of America (CoSIDA) Academic All-America selection as she was named to the Academic All-America Third Team on Tuesday.

Graf was one of six pitchers in NCAA Division III named to one of the three Academic All-America teams and one of six Minnesota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(MIAC) student-athletes among the 34 honorees from across the country. She is also the 12th Academic All-America honoree in school history and the fourth in the last two years.

A three-time All-MIAC honoree, three-time National Fastpitch Coaches Association (NFCA) All-Region selection and 2017 NFCA Second Team All-American, Graf has made 106 appearances (81 starts) in her career at St. Olaf and has recorded a 59-29 record with a 1.40 ERA. She holds the school and MIAC all-time records with 920 strikeouts in 550 innings and ranks 23rd in NCAA Division III history in the category.

At the conclusion of the spring, Graf led all pitchers at all levels of the NCAA in career strikeouts per seven innings (11.71) and ranked third in career strikeouts. Among active NCAA Division III pitchers, Graf ranks second in five categories (appearances, starts, innings pitched, wins and strikeouts) and was sixth in two more (ERA and shutouts). Through six appearances (four starts) this season, Graf was 4-0 with a 0.79 ERA and ranked eighth in the country with 62 strikeouts in just 26.2 innings of work.

Academically, Graf is double-majoring in exercise science and psychology and holds a 3.54 cumulative GPA. Last spring, she was named to the MIAC Academic All-Conference team and earned Easton NFCA Scholar-Athlete honors. She was named a CoSIDA Academic All-District honoree last month to advance to the Academic All-America ballot.

In order to be eligible for Academic All-District and Academic All-America honors, a student-athlete must be a starter or important reserve with at least a 3.30 cumulative grade point average (on a 4.0 scale) at his/her current institution, have completed one full calendar year at his/her current institution, and have reached sophomore athletic eligibility. Due to the cancellation of most of the spring season, the nominating/voting process relied on career statistics in place of current season statistics this year.
